- definition : contains the definition json files for the numpad to be recognized by the usevia.app application.
- layout : via json layouts for the numpad.
- zuoya : contain an exe that will flash the lmk21 numpad to its default configuration.
Here's some basic instructions for pairing the numpad with via web application :
- Connect the numpad
- Open https://www.usevia.app/
- Go to the Settings tab
- Enable 'Show Design tab'
- In the Design tab, enable 'Use V2 definitions (deprecated)'
- Now click on 'Load' and browse to the JSON definition file
- Connection request should pop-up
Tip
In case saving a layout is not working in the web app : the-via/releases#241
This is due to a missing permission (file system access API) in the browser settings.
Warning
Zuoya is on the license violator list of QMK (https://docs.qmk.fm/license_violations) it is unlikely we'll have a release of the QMK firmware from them.
Additionnaly the MCU used in the LKM21 numpad to provide tri-connectivity modes may not be officialy supported by QMK.